Output 1066160c23d75b18c24bc24effc53aacf4185d680755d516eb97e8cb024ee09f:81

value
384362355
script pubkey
OP_0 OP_PUSHBYTES_32 17fbf0acaeeba8dc6a61f5f5ce6935afb2f851b7e52c1e40fb17b3cc8ac061fe
address
bc1qzlalpt9waw5dc6np7h6uu6f447e0s5dhu5kpus8mz7euezkqv8lqyqpzg4
transaction
1066160c23d75b18c24bc24effc53aacf4185d680755d516eb97e8cb024ee09f
spent
true